Abstract

An overview of GIS and SCADA systems for use in agro-industrial precision farming is presented. A systematization of the stages of its development based on the use of digital technologies and artificial intelligence (AI) is given. The main information about the features of the new domestic SCADA system of the 4-th generation, suitable for monitoring and managing digital objects of the agro-industrial complex, developed taking into account modern world standards, is given. The architecture and feature of AggreGate SCADA/HMI, which belongs to the 4th generation of SCADA systems, the Internet of things IoT, are presented. Recommendations on the use of digital technologies and AI in agro-industrial production of the 4-th generation are given. The main requirements for the developed systems of intelligent management of irrigated agriculture based on the use of artificial intelligence systems are defined. A review of SCADA systems offered by manufacturers has shown that they can solve not only generalized, but also specific tasks of agricultural production.
